Taylor Swift has been busy preparing for her RED Tour for months, and last night (March 13) in Omaha, Nebraska, she welcomed fans into her world.
“Well, good evening. You see this is the part I’ve been really looking forward to for a very long time because this is the part where I say to you, Omaha, Nebraska, welcome to the very first night of the RED Tour,” Swift said to the crowd as she jumped up and down.
The more than 13,800 fans at the CenturyLink Center took a liking to her show, a two-hour extravaganza that included multi-level stages, elaborate costumes, dancers, and even aerialists. The local critics agreed.
“For the first four songs of Swift’s kickoff concert of The Red Tour, screams, whistles and cheers melded with her powerful backup band to create a relentless cacophony,” a reviewer at The Omaha World Herald reported.
